Repacks traditionally relied on H.264 (AVC) encoding, but modern variants heavily employ H.265 (HEVC) or the royalty-free AV1 standard. These newer codecs provide superior data compression, enabling a 1080p video file to look remarkably crisp even when compressed down to a size profile of 700MB to 1.5GB.

The viability of sites like HD9xmovieco relies entirely on high-efficiency video encoding. Without sophisticated compression algorithms, transferring high-definition or ultra-high-definition data across standard consumer internet connections would be highly inefficient.
